AES加密解密
AES加密解密工具,AES加密算法加密解密
- AES加密
- AES解密
明文:
請輸入要加密的字符
密文:
加密后,密文會(huì )顯示在這里
可以為不填寫(xiě),但使用密鑰更安全
開(kāi)始加密
密文:
請輸入待解密的密文
明文:
解密后,結果會(huì )在這里顯示
如果有,必須填寫(xiě)加密時(shí)用的密鑰
開(kāi)始解密
AES加密解密
AES加密解密工具使用:
1、明文:需要加密的字符串,長(cháng)度不受限制。
2、加密密鑰:加密或解密需要提供的密碼,如果填寫(xiě)密鑰,必須牢記,否則無(wú)法正確解密。
3、密文:加密后的字符串,由字符、數字等字符組成。
AES加密解密工具,使用AES加密算法,實(shí)現加密、解密。AES(高級加密標準)英文全稱(chēng):Advanced Encryption Standard。AES算法又稱(chēng)Rijndael加密法,是對稱(chēng)加密算法,是美國聯(lián)邦政府采用的一種區塊加密標準,這個(gè)標準用來(lái)替代原先的DES(Data Encryption Standard)。AES算法的安全性較高,是對稱(chēng)加密算法中被應用最廣的一種算法。
AES算法優(yōu)點(diǎn):
1.AES加密解密的運行速度快。
2.AES對環(huán)境要求低,對內存的占用小。
3.安全系數高,AES密鑰長(cháng)度可變,可以為128位、192位和256位,就現今的計算機速度,幾乎不可能對AES加密進(jìn)行窮舉暴力破解。誤差也不會(huì )被傳送,具有很好的抗線(xiàn)性密碼分析和抵抗差分密碼分析的能力。AES現在已經(jīng)受了最嚴格的考驗。
1.AES加密解密的運行速度快。
2.AES對環(huán)境要求低,對內存的占用小。
3.安全系數高,AES密鑰長(cháng)度可變,可以為128位、192位和256位,就現今的計算機速度,幾乎不可能對AES加密進(jìn)行窮舉暴力破解。誤差也不會(huì )被傳送,具有很好的抗線(xiàn)性密碼分析和抵抗差分密碼分析的能力。AES現在已經(jīng)受了最嚴格的考驗。
AES算法不足:
雖然已經(jīng)提出對其簡(jiǎn)化算法的攻擊,但至今為止,還沒(méi)有過(guò)對AES算法的成功攻擊。
雖然已經(jīng)提出對其簡(jiǎn)化算法的攻擊,但至今為止,還沒(méi)有過(guò)對AES算法的成功攻擊。